68 Cutlass Sail Panel Interior Lights

I can't seem to find anyone who sells repop interior sail panel lights for my 68 Supreme coupe.

Are these lights a one year only deal?

The only interior lights I seem to find are round dome lights, but my car has one rectangular light on each sail panel by the rear window and no dome light.

If anyone knows where I could get these, please help me out.

68cuttysupreme is correct. I have these same "opera" lights in the sail panels of my '69 Supreme. The ones you need are only on Supremes in '68 and '69. The ones for other years are different.
I got replacement lenses for mine from a guy on Epay
